  • Patent number: 9900224
    Abstract: A system and method for implementing and management virtual networks is disclosed. A method includes receiving a network packet arriving at a first network interface of a first node of an underlying network, communicating at least the packet and an identifier of the first network interface to a decision engine, determining how the packet should be processed based on a simulation by the decision engine of a traversal of a virtual network topology including a plurality of virtual network devices, wherein the decision engine communicates with a shared database accessible from the underlying network that stores the virtual network topology and virtual device configurations for the plurality of virtual network devices; and processing the packet based upon the simulation.

  • Patent number: 8849852
    Abstract: Methods and systems for improving text segmentation are disclosed. In one embodiment, at least a first segmented result and a second segmented result are determined from a string of characters, a first frequency of occurrence for the first segmented result and a second frequency of occurrence for the second segmented result are determined, and an operable segmented result is identified from the first segmented result and the second segmented result based at least in part on the first frequency of occurrence and the second frequency of occurrence.

  • Patent number: 8489387
    Abstract: Methods and systems for selecting a language for text segmentation are disclosed. In one embodiment, at least a first candidate language and a second candidate language associated with a string of characters are identified, at least a first segmented result associated with the first candidate language and a second segmented result associated with the second candidate language are determined, a first frequency of occurrence for the first segmented result and a second frequency of occurrence for the second segmented result are determined, and an operable language is identified from the first candidate language and the second candidate language based at least in part on the first frequency of occurrence and the second frequency of occurrence.

  • Publication number: 20090024470
    Abstract: A technique, method, apparatus, and system to provide related ad link units with vertical clustered or anti-clustered categories to be displayed with web page content for view by a user. In one implementation, a method is provided. The method includes selecting a first ad link category for a first position of an ad link unit. One or more second ad link categories are identified using one or more similarity measures, where at least one second ad link category has one or more similarity measures associated with the first ad link category.
